Job description
Key Areas of Responsibility
Clinical
• Lead the delivery of nursing services across both sites
• Provide high-quality care for acute and long-term conditions
• Prioritise urgent cases and initiate emergency care when needed
• Maintain accurate, comprehensive records and documentation
• Prescribe within clinical competence (if qualified)
• Deliver care in accordance with local and national guidelines
• Undertake procedures including:
• Cervical cytology
• Immunisation and vaccination
• Wound management
• Venepuncture
• BP and spirometry monitoring
• Travel health advice
• Health screening and lifestyle education
Teaching and Mentorship
• Support the practice team with the mentorship of students.
Managerial
• Act as a role model and team leader
• Manage nursing team rotas, annual leave, and sickness cover
• Lead on protocol development and service improvement
• Contribute to management meetings and quality assurance initiatives
• Support practice performance targets and contractual compliance
Professional
• Maintain NMC registration and CPD
• Adhere to all mandatory training requirements
• Work within the NMC Code and NHS guidelines
• Promote equality, diversity, and inclusion in all aspects of the role
• Handle sensitive information with discretion and in line with GDPR
